</element><element id="paragraph-1" type="body"><![CDATA[Norman Diefenbach, 83, Harrisburg, died at 12:25 p.m. Sunday, June 24, 2012, at Shawnee Rose Care Center in Harrisburg.
Funeral services will be held 3 p.m. Wednesday, July 27, 2012, at Felty Funeral Home in Carrier Mills. Visitation will be held after 2 p.m. Wednesday. The Rev. John Hancock will officiate. Burial will be at 12:30 p.m. Thursday, June 28, 2012, at Mounds City National Cemetery in Mounds City with military rites by the Carrier Mills American Legion, Harrisburg American Legion and the National Guard Ritual Team.
He was on Oct. 8, 1928, at Stonefort to the late Louis and Clara (Brandon) Diefenbach.
He married Edna Hancock on July 21, 1949, and she survives.
Norman joined the Navy at the age of 17 at the end of World War II. He was assigned to the c.b.'s (Construction Battalion helping rebuild the Pacific Islands). He went to work at Caterpillar Tractor in the early 1950's, and retired after 30 years and moved back to Southern Illinois. He loved working outdoors; he was an avid gardener and master beekeeper.
He is survived by his wife, Edna Diefenbach; three daughters: Lenora Krause, Shirley (Rich) Erickson and Sandy (Kevin) Obrakta; six grandchildren; three great-grandchildren; a sister, Eva Hancock; a brother, Bertis (Joyce) Diefenbach; and several nieces and nephews.
He was preceded in death by a granddaughter, Bonnie Erickson Howard; four sisters; and four brothers.
